Data Science Manager, Risk

Fig
Posted 7 hours ago
🇨🇦Canada🏢Hybrid💰CA$95.0K–CA$120.0K📁Data & Analytics

About Fig Fig is an award-winning, high-growth Canadian FinTech modernizing the world of consumer credit. We provide simple, accessible and fully digital personal loans, removing the complexity and delays of traditional lending to better serve Canadians. Since launching in 2023, Fig has quickly built a strong reputation for innovation and customer trust. We have been named Consumer Lender of the Year by the Canadian Lenders Association and FinTech Startup of the Year by the FinTech Breakthrough Awards, and we are consistently recognized among Canada’s Best Workplaces. Our commitment to customers is reflected in our 4.8 out of 5 Trustpilot rating. Backed by Fairstone Bank of Canada and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an, Fig combines deep lending expertise with the agility of a startup. This foundation allows us to effectively meet the evolving credit needs of Canadians across a wide range of financial backgrounds. The Role: Credit Risk Expert & Strategic Builder We are looking for a hands-on, data-obsessed Data Science Manager, Risk to build and operationalize the models, data pipelines, and analytical frameworks that power our lending decisions. Reporting to the Director of Credit Risk, you will play a key role in advancing our credit risk capabilities through machine learning, data engineering, model governance, and data-driven experimentation. While this role does not include people management responsibilities in the short term, you will provide technical leadership by driving cross-functional initiatives, mentoring junior analysts, and championing best practices in data science and risk modeling. You'll join an experienced team focused on Getting Stuff Done (#GSD), where curiosity, scientific rigor, and continuous innovation drive every decision. You'll work across the full model lifecycle from developing and deploying models to monitoring, governing, and continuously improving their performance. You should be comfortable navigating ambiguity, solving complex analytical problems, and translating insights into scalable, production-ready solutions. This is an exciting opportunity to work across multiple data science disciplines, including credit risk model development, alternative labeling strategies, reject inference, model validation and quality assurance, feature engineering, model monitoring, production decisioning, and credit risk data engineering. You'll design robust data pipelines, improve model performance and governance, automate analytical workflows, and partner closely with Credit Strategy, Product, Finance, Growth and Engineering to deliver scalable, data-driven lending solutions. This is a newly created role, which means you’ll have the opportunity to help shape the mandate, build core processes, and make a visible impact as Fig continues to grow. Culture matters deeply to us. You'll have the support of experienced colleagues across the organization who are passionate about solving challenging problems together. We're looking for someone who combines strong technical expertise with curiosity, collaborates effectively across teams, and thrives in an environment that values transparency, accountability, and continuous improvement. What You’ll Do Develop Next-Generation Credit Models: Build, enhance, and deploy machine learning models for underwriting, reject inference, alternative labeling, and other credit risk applications. Drive Model Governance & Quality: Partner with model validation to ensure robust model governance through comprehensive documentation, performance monitoring, stability analysis, diagnostics, and ongoing model enhancements. Advance Credit Strategy: Partner with the Credit Risk team to evaluate underwriting policies, optimize risk segmentation, and translate model insights into data-driven credit strategies. Enable Scalable Credit Analytics: Develop analytical datasets, reusable feature frameworks, and scalable workflows that accelerate model development, portfolio monitoring, and strategic decision-making. Drive Statistical Experimentation: Design and evaluate statistically rigorous experiments to assess new models, features, and credit strategies, using data to quantify business impact and optimize decision-making. Productionize Decisioning: Translate analytical solutions into scalable production workflows, partnering with Engineering to automate credit decisioning and improve operational efficiency. Build AI-Powered Solutions: Develop and deploy AI-powered solutions across credit risk and fraud to enhance decision-making, strengthen fraud detection, and improve operational efficiency. Collaborate Across Teams: Partner closely with Credit Strategy, Product, Growth, Finance, Engineering, and Data teams to deliver high-quality, data-driven solutions that balance portfolio growth, risk, and customer experience. What You’ll Bring Subject Matter Experience : 4 or more years of experience in Credit Risk management, modeling and/or related data analysis in a financial services, FinTech, lending and/or technology company. Technical Mastery : Strong proficiency in Python and SQL is required. Analytical Depth : Working knowledge of regression analysis, decision trees, loss forecasting, and statistical design of experiments. Exceptional Communication Skills : The ability to translate complex data into clear, professional narratives for Senior Management. Startup DNA : You thrive in fast-paced environments with limited structure and have a shared sense of purpose to "Get Stuff Done" (#GSD). Why Fig? Make Your Mark: This is a rare chance to help directly steward a high-impact FinTech in Canada at an exciting stage of its growth and maturity. The Culture: Work in a team that values impact, accountability, curiosity, and building strong, collaborative relationships. Hybrid Work Environment: Balance of remote and in-office (currently one day a week in Toronto), without sacrificing the high-energy collaboration. Competitive compensation ($95,000 – $120,000 base + bonus). Retirement savings program with employer matching.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ision group insurance, as well as health and wellness spending accounts. Generous time off to help you recharge. Parental top-up to support your growing family. Continuing education stipend to support your professional development.
